Awarapan 2 Teaser Is Here: Emraan Hashmi Says ‘Dard Se Purana Rishta Hai’
Nearly two decades after the original captured hearts, Emraan Hashmi is stepping back into the shadows as the iconic Shivam Pandit. The teaser for Awarapan 2 dropped on June 29, 2026 — exactly 19 years after the 2007 cult classic left audiences mesmerised — and it’s already making waves across social media.
Emraan Hashmi’s Awarapan 2 Teaser: What We Know
The teaser reintroduces Emraan in his brooding avatar, delivering the haunting line: ‘Dard se purana rishta hai mera.’ It’s a statement that instantly channels the dark, melancholic soul of the original film and signals that the sequel won’t shy away from raw, intense storytelling.

Star-Studded Cast for the Sequel
- Emraan Hashmi reprising his career-defining role as Shivam Pandit
- Disha Patani joining the franchise in a yet-to-be-disclosed role
- Shabana Azmi lending gravitas and depth to the narrative
The combination of Emraan’s brooding intensity, Disha’s screen presence, and Shabana Azmi’s acclaimed acting pedigree makes this one of the most anticipated releases of the year.
Box Office Clash on Independence Day Weekend
Awarapan 2 is scheduled to hit cinemas on August 14, 2026, placing it squarely in the Independence Day weekend window. However, it will face stiff competition as it goes head-to-head with Lahore 1947 at the box office — a clash that has already set the trade buzzing.
Analysts tracking entertainment industry coverage suggest that both films targeting the same release date could result in one of the most talked-about box office face-offs of 2026.
Why Awarapan 2 Matters
The original Awarapan (2007) was directed by Mohit Suri and became a landmark film for Emraan Hashmi, cementing his reputation as Bollywood’s master of intense, emotionally-charged roles. A sequel arriving 19 years later carries enormous nostalgia value alongside the pressure of living up to a beloved legacy.
With the teaser already generating strong buzz, all eyes are now on the full trailer and what the complete story of Shivam Pandit’s return will reveal.

Annu Kapoor: Four Decades of Brilliance and Counting
**Annu Kapoor: Four Decades of Brilliance and Counting**
One of Indian cinema’s most enduring and versatile talents is celebrating a remarkable career landmark, with veteran performer Annu Kapoor having dedicated well over four decades of his life to the world of entertainment.
Born on February 20, 1956, the celebrated artist has built an extraordinary body of work that stretches across more than 130 film appearances, according to publicly available records. His contributions to Indian cinema span multiple genres, demonstrating a rare adaptability that few in the industry can claim.
Sources reveal that Kapoor’s talents extend far beyond the silver screen. The multi-hyphenate star has worn many hats throughout his illustrious journey — actor, singer, director, and even radio presenter — making him one of the most well-rounded personalities in the entertainment world.

Sunny Deol Reprises Lawyer Role in Ikka After Damini Sequel Failed
Studio CarryOnHarry Entertainment Desk | 29 June 2026
After more than three decades, Bollywood powerhouse Sunny Deol is stepping back into the courtroom — and back into the hearts of fans who never forgot his electrifying legal drama debut. The veteran actor is set to reprise his iconic lawyer role in the highly anticipated film Ikka, reigniting memories of his landmark 1993 blockbuster Damini.
In a candid revelation that has sent entertainment circles buzzing, Deol has disclosed that he spent years attempting to bring a sequel to Damini to life — an ambition that ultimately never came to fruition. Sources reveal the project remained a persistent passion for the actor, despite multiple attempts to get it off the ground.
The news adds a deeply personal dimension to Ikka, suggesting the film may carry the emotional weight of unfinished business for the seasoned star.
